0.25 cups of olive oil equals approximately 55 grams. This conversion is essential for air fryer recipes, where precise measurements can make or break your dish. Whether you’re drizzling oil over vegetables or mixing it into batter, knowing the exact gram equivalent ensures consistency. Why Accurate Olive Oil Measurements Matter
Using the right amount of olive oil in your air fryer ensures even cooking and prevents excess grease. Too little oil can leave food dry, while too much may cause uneven crisping. For recipes like roasted vegetables or crispy chicken, 0.25 cups of olive oil (55 grams) is often the ideal amount. Check out our air fryer conversion chart for more handy measurements.
Olive oil is a staple in Mediterranean and air fryer cooking due to its high smoke point and health benefits. Whether you’re preparing a quick vegetable dish or a hearty meal, precise measurements guarantee better texture and flavour. Always measure oil by weight (grams) for baking, as volume (cups) can vary slightly.
How to Measure 0.25 Cups of Olive Oil
To measure 0.25 cups of olive oil accurately, use a liquid measuring cup or a kitchen scale. If using cups, fill to the quarter-cup mark, ensuring the oil sits level. For grams, place your container on the scale, tare it, then pour until it reaches 55 grams. This method eliminates guesswork and improves recipe consistency.

Common Uses for 0.25 Cups of Olive Oil
This measurement is perfect for coating vegetables, marinating proteins, or greasing air fryer baskets. For instance, tossing potatoes in 55 grams of olive oil before air frying ensures even crisping. It’s also ideal for recipes like chicken wings, where precise oil distribution prevents sogginess.
Tips for Storing and Using Olive Oil
Store olive oil in a cool, dark place to maintain its quality. When measuring 0.25 cups (55 grams), ensure the oil is at room temperature for accuracy. Avoid overheating olive oil in the air fryer, as it can lose its nutritional benefits. For cleaning residue, try our recommended air fryer cleaner to keep your appliance in top shape.
Experiment with different olive oil brands to find your preferred flavour profile. Extra virgin olive oil works well for dressings, while lighter varieties suit high-heat air frying.
